try-catch 原理:try-catch 是一种异常处理机制,用于捕获和处理代码中可能抛出的异常。当程序执行到 try 块时,会按照顺序执行其中的代码;如果 try 块中的代码执行异常,程序会立即跳转到与 catch 关键字对应的 catch 块中执行;在 catch 块中,可以对异常进行捕获和处理,比如打印错误信息、记录日志、或者进行一些恢复性操作;如果 catch 块中的代码执行完毕,程序会继续执行 try-catch 块之后的代码;Future 原理:Future 是 Dart 中用于处理异步操作的关键字之一。当调用一个异步函数时,该函数会立即返回一个 Future 对象,表示异步操...